An unannounced monitoring inspection was conducted on 01/05/2023 between the hours of approximately 11:35 a.m. and 12:50 p.m. There were 13 children (1 of 13 resides in the home) present with the Provider and 2 assistants for a total of 33 points within the supervision guidelines. The children were observed eating lunch and engaging in free play. Positive interactions were observed during this inspection. A complete inspection of the physical plant, children and staff records, fire drill log, menu, and attendance were observed during this inspection. Information gathered during the inspection determined non-compliance with applicable standards or law and violations were documented on the violation notice issued to the program. Violations:
Standard #: 22.1-289.058
Description: Based on observation and caregiver interview, the family day home did not have a working carbon monoxide detector.

Evidence: Caregiver #1 stated that there was not a carbon monoxide detector in the home.

Plan of Correction: I will buy one today.

Standard #: 8VAC20-800-340-C
Description: Based on observation, the bathroom did not contain paper towels.

Evidence:
1. The bathroom used by the children in care did not contain paper towels.

2. Child #2 was observed drying their hands with a cloth towel in the bathroom after washing their hands.

Plan of Correction: I will put some in the bathroom today.

Standard #: 8VAC20-800-540-A
Description: Based on observation, high chair safety straps were not used and securely fastened, when occupied by a child.

Evidence:
1. The high chair safety strap was not fastened as Child #2 sat in the chair for lunch.
2. The high chair safety strap was not fastened as Child #5 sat in the chair for lunch.
3. The high chair safety strap was not fastened as Child #6 sat in the chair for lunch.
4. The high chair safety strap was not securely fastened as Child #8 sat in the chair for lunch.
5. The high chair safety strap was not fastened as Child #2 sat in the chair for lunch.

Plan of Correction: We will use the straps.
